We are seeking experienced Employment/Wrongful Termination attorneys to join our legal team. The ideal candidate must have a deep understanding of employment law and a proven track record of successfully representing clients in cases of wrongful termination, discrimination, harassment, retaliation, and other employment-related matters.

Responsibilities:

- Represent clients in a variety of employment law cases, including wrongful termination, discrimination, harassment, and retaliation

- Conduct legal research and analysis to develop case strategies

- Draft legal documents, including complaints, motions, and briefs

- Communicate with clients, opposing counsel, and judges

- Attend court hearings, arbitrations, and mediations

- Negotiate settlements on behalf of clients

- Stay current on changes in employment law and legal trends

Qualifications:

- Juris Doctor degree from an ABA-accredited law school

- Active license to practice law in the state where the position is located

- Minimum of 2 years of experience practicing employment law

- Strong research, writing, and analytical skills

- Excellent communication and negotiation abilities

- Ability to manage a high-volume caseload and work independently

- Proven track record of successful outcomes in employment law cases
